Almond Croissant Banana Bread Ingredients

Get ready to bake this delightful twist on a classic!

For the Bread

  • Ripe Bananas – Adds natural sweetness and moisture; overripe bananas yield the best results.
  • Almond Extract – Infuses a rich almond flavor; if you’re out, vanilla extract works well too.
  • Brown Sugar – Offers caramel notes and moisture; white sugar is a suitable substitute but changes flavor slightly.
  • All-Purpose Flour – Forms the backbone of the bread; try gluten-free flour for a gluten-free option.
  • Eggs – Bind the ingredients together for structure; for a vegan alternative, flax eggs are perfect.
  • Baking Powder – Ensures the bread rises beautifully; fresh baking powder is key to great texture.

For the Topping

  • Slivered Almonds – Adds a delightful crunch and elegance to the bread; can be swapped with chopped walnuts or pecans for variation.

How to Make Almond Croissant Banana Bread

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a loaf pan by greasing it with cooking spray or laying down parchment paper for easy removal later.

  2. Mash ripe bananas in a mixing bowl until smooth, then stir in brown sugar, eggs, and almond extract, blending until everything is well combined.

  3. Mix together flour,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l. Gradually add this dry mixture to the banana blend, stirring gently until just combined.

  4. Fold in slivered almonds, ensuring they’re evenly distributed throughout the batter. Pour the mixture into the prepared loaf pan, smoothing the top with a spatula.

  5. Bake for about 45 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, indicating a perfectly risen loaf.

  6. C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ully.

Optional: Drizzle with honey for an extra touch of sweetness!

Make Ahead Options

These Almond Croissant Banana Bread loaves are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time! You can prepare the batter up to 24 hours in advance. Simply mash the ripe bananas and combine them with the brown sugar, eggs, and almond extract, then store the mixture in a tightly sealed container in the refrigerator to maintain freshness. For optimal quality, keep the dry ingredients (flour, baking powder, and salt) separate and mix them just before you’re ready to bake. When you’re ready to enjoy your homemade loaf, fold in the slivered almonds, pour the batter into your prepared pan, and bake as directed. Expert Tips for Almond Croissant Banana Bread

  • Choose Perfect Bananas: Use very ripe bananas for maximum sweetness; avoid under-ripe ones as they won’t provide enough moisture.

  • Mix Gently: Combine the ingredients just until they are mixed; overmixing can lead to a dense Almond Croissant Banana Bread that’s not as light and fluffy.

  • Check Your Oven Temperature: Baking times can vary between ovens; use a toothpick to check for doneness, and remove it as soon as it comes out clean.

  • Storage Secrets: Wrap slices in plastic wrap to keep your banana bread fresh for up to a week; it also freezes well for later enjoyment.

Storage Tips for Almond Croissant Banana Bread

Room Temperature: Store the loaf in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days to maintain its freshness and flavor.

Fridge: For longer storage, wrap tightly in plastic wrap and refrigerate for up to a week; this helps retain moisture and taste.

Freezer: You can freeze slices of Almond Croissant Banana Bread for up to 3 months; simply wrap each slice in plastic and then place in a freezer bag for optimal freshness.

Reheating: To enjoy, reheat slices in the microwave for about 20-30 seconds or pop them in the toaster for a crispy texture, bringing that freshly baked taste back!

Almond Croissant Banana Bread Recipe FAQs

What ripeness of bananas should I use?
Absolutely! Use very ripe bananas for the best results. Look for bananas that are heavily speckled with brown spots; this indicates high sugar content which ensures your Almond Croissant Banana Bread will be sweet and moist.

How should I store the Almond Croissant Banana Bread?
For short-term storage, keep the loaf in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, tightly wrap it in plastic wrap and refrigerate for up to a week. This helps keep the loaf moist while preserving its flavor.

Can I freeze Almond Croissant Banana Bread?
Yes, you can! To freeze, slice the bread first and wrap each slice individually in plastic wrap. Place the wrapped slices in a freezer bag to protect them from freezer burn. It will stay fresh for up to 3 months! When you’re ready to enjoy, just reheat in the microwave or toaster.

What should I do if my bread is too dense?
If your Almond Croissant Banana Bread turns out dense, there might be a couple of culprits. First, ensure your bananas are fully ripe to contribute moisture. Second, mix the batter gently—overmixing can lead to a dense texture. If it’s too late and the bread is already baked, try slicing it thinner for a lighter bite!

Is this recipe suitable for those with nut allergies?
If you’re baking for someone with nut allergies, it’s best to avoid using both almonds and almond extract in the recipe. You can simply omit the slivered almonds and swap almond extract for vanilla extract, ensuring a delicious banana bread experience without the nut ingredients.

Can I make this recipe vegan?
Yes, absolutely! To make your Almond Croissant Banana Bread vegan, substitute the eggs with flax eggs or applesauce. Use 1 tablespoon of ground flaxseed mixed with 2.5 tablespoons of water per egg, letting it sit for a few minutes to thicken. This maintains the binding quality the eggs provide!

Delicious Almond Croissant Banana Bread for Easy Baking Bliss

This Almond Croissant Banana Bread combines the rich essence of almond croissants with the comfort of banana bread, making it a delightful treat.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 45 minutes
Cooling Time 10 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 10 minutes
Servings: 10 slices
Course: BAKING
Cuisine: American
Calories: 200

Ingredients
  

For the Bread
  • 3 medium ripe bananas overripe gives the best results
  • 1 teaspoon almond extract can substitute with v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ar white sugar can be substituted
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our gluten-free flour can be used
  • 2 large eggs flax eggs can be used for vegan option
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der ensure it's fresh for best texture
For the Topping
  • 1/2 cup slivered almonds chopped walnuts or pecans can be used

Equipment

  • loaf pan
  • mixing bowl
  • spatula

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a loaf pan by greasing it with cooking spray or laying down parchment paper.
  2. Mash ripe bananas in a mixing bowl until smooth, then stir in brown sugar, eggs, and almond extract until well combined.
  3. Mix together flour,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l. Gradually add this dry mixture to the banana blend, stirring gently until just combined.
  4. Fold in slivered almonds, ensuring they’re evenly distributed. Pour the mixture into the prepared loaf pan.
  5. Bake for about 45 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  6. C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
